Abstract

An apparatus and method for fabricating a spherical shaped semiconductor integrated circuit according to which a chamber is provided into which spheres of a semiconductor material are introduced therein. Process gases are also selectively introduced into the chamber. The chamber includes a metallic portion that is selectively provided a voltage. Upon receiving the voltage, the chamber attracts ions from the process gases, at least some of the attracted ions treating the spheres according to a particular aspect of the fabrication process.
